The clue "tea with tapioca pearls" almost universally points to the beloved beverage known as bubble tea, or 'boba tea'. Originating from Taiwan in the 1980s, this unique drink has captured the hearts of many globally, becoming a cultural phenomenon. Its distinct feature is the inclusion of chewy tapioca pearls, often called boba, which are made from cassava starch and provide a delightful texture that complements the tea base.

Bubble tea comes in a vast array of flavors and styles, from classic milk teas to refreshing fruit infusions and creamy slushies. The versatility of the drink means it can be customized with various toppings beyond just tapioca pearls, such as fruit jellies, popping boba, or puddings. What is bubble tea?

Bubble tea is a diverse range of tea-based drinks, often mixed with milk or fruit flavors, and famously includes chewy tapioca pearls, known as boba, which sit at the bottom of the cup.

Where did tapioca pearls in bubble tea come from?

Tapioca pearls are made from cassava root starch. Their incorporation into tea drinks originated in Taiwan in the 1980s, becoming a signature ingredient of bubble tea.

Are there different types of bubble tea?

Yes, bubble tea comes in many varieties, including milk teas, fruit teas, slushies, and even lattes. The pearls can also vary, from classic black tapioca to flavored popping boba or jellies.
